JAMF was delisted on the 29th of January, 2026.
208 hedge funds and large institutions have $1.63B invested in Jamf in 2025 Q4 according to their latest regulatory filings, with 69 funds opening new positions, 55 increasing their positions, 64 reducing their positions, and 59 closing their positions.
